Abstract

The utility model discloses an energy-saving boiler for a main furnace and an auxiliary furnace. The energy-saving boiler comprises a main furnace (1), an auxiliary furnace (2), a water feeding pipe (3), a water discharging pipe (4), a furnace cover (5), a chimney (6), a grate bar disc (7), a furnace door (8) and an ash door (9). The energy-saving boiler is characterized in that a main furnace water jacket (10) is communicated with an auxiliary furnace water jacket (11); the auxiliary furnace (2) is internally provided with clapboard water jackets (13 and 14) with flues (12) arranged at two sides, and a clapboard water sleeve (16) with a flue (15) arranged in the middle part; the clapboard water jacket (16) is arranged between the clapboard water jackets (13 and 14); and all clapboard water jackets (16) are communicated with the auxiliary furnace water jacket (11). The energy-saving boiler has the advantages that the high-temperature smoke fire can be sufficiently absorbed by water in a plurality of clapboard water jackets; the heat energy can be utilized to maximum degree, thus achieving the aim of saving energy; the smoke fire advances circularly in curved flue; a large amount of dusts are deposited in the auxiliary furnace and are not emitted to the atmosphere, thus reducing the dust emission; and the energy-saving boiler has simple structure and is easy to manufacture.

Technical field
The utility model relates to a kind of boiler.
Background technology
At present, mostly boiler is to have only a main stove, does not have secondary stove, and be that the high temperature pyrotechnics in the burner hearth is directly drained into the atmosphere from chimney, both contained a large amount of dust in the high temperature pyrotechnics, contain a large amount of heat energy again, not only cause serious atmosphere pollution, and cause serious energy dissipation.
Summary of the invention
The purpose of this utility model is to provide a kind of major-minor stove power economized boiler of energy-conserving and environment-protective.
Technical solution adopted in the utility model is, this major-minor stove power economized boiler, comprise main stove, secondary stove, water inlet pipe, outlet pipe, bell, chimney, stove rod plate, fire door, Hui Men, main stove water jacket is communicated with secondary stove water jacket, in secondary stove, be provided with two both sides and leave the dividing plate water jacket that flue is left in centre of dividing plate water sleeve of flue, the dividing plate water jacket that flue is left in the centre leaves two both sides between the dividing plate water jacket of flue, and they all are communicated with secondary stove water jacket.
Owing to taked technique scheme, so the utility model advantage is as follows: the one, be provided with a plurality of dividing plate water jackets in the secondary stove, the flue that high temperature pyrotechnics in the burner hearth constitutes through these a plurality of dividing plate water jackets, heat energy wherein is inevitable fully to be absorbed by the water in a plurality of dividing plate water jackets, utilize heat energy substantially, reach energy-conservation purpose.The 2nd, pyrotechnics follows row in the curved flue that a plurality of dividing plate water jackets constitute, and wherein a large amount of dust will sink in secondary stove, and unlikely draining in the atmosphere reduced dust emission, played environmental-protection function.The 3rd, simple in structure, be easy to make.
